As the empire crumbled, the Inca and their descendants made a valiant attempt to preserve the symbols of imperial authority. Servants collected the precious bodies of the sacred kings and concealed them around Cusco, where they were worshipped in secret—and in defiance of Spanish priests. Inca, South American Indians who, at the time of the Spanish conquest in 1532, ruled an empire that extended along the Pacific coast and Andean highlands from the northern border of modern Ecuador to the Maule River in central Chile. Maybe you've heard some Cusquenians say that the multicolored flag is the flag of Tawantinsuyu, meaning it came from the very Inca Empire. However, that is a lie. There's no historical evidence to prove that claim. On top of that, according to specialists and historians, the concept of a "flag" was imported from Europe.

The incredibly rapid expansion of the Inca empire began with Viracocha's son Pachacuti Inca Yupanqui, one of the great conquerors—and one of the great individuals—in the history of the Americas.
